Boston Speech and Language Therapy in Providence, RI seeks an SLPA to work under the supervision of a licensed Speech Language Pathologist in an elementary school setting. The role focuses on delivering therapy sessions and supporting assessment and documentation.
Hourly pay ranges from $40 to $50, commensurate with experience. The team emphasizes manageable caseloads and a supportive work environment, with ongoing training and collaboration with school staff.
